Fire of God

Isaiah 33:14-16 – Who among us shall dwell with the devouring fire? Who among us shall dwell with everlasting burnings? He who walks righteously and speaks uprightly, he who despises the gain of oppression, who gestures with his hands, refusing bribes, who stops his ears from hearing of bloodshed, and shuts his eyes from seeing evil: He will dwell on high; his place of defense will be the fortress of rocks; bread will be given him, his water will be sure.

The prophet Isaiah ask a very relevant question that all of us must ask as leaders: Who can stand up under God’s purification process? Who can remain unchanged through the fire of God? If we are to be the leaders that God has called us to be, we must posses certain character qualities. God cannot trust just anyone to be a leader among His people; He only chooses those who are capable!

In this passage Isaiah lays out a list of necessary traits for leadership. He says that these leadership traits are the kind that can stand up under the fire of judgment and crisis. Why don’t you take a little test and see if you have the ingredients it takes to be used as a leader. Now remember, be honest with yourself and with God…

  1. Integrity: The leader’s life and words match.
  2. Justice: The leader rejects dishonest gain.
  3. Convictions: The leader’s values won’t allow him or her to accept bribes.
  4. Positive focus: The leader refuses to dwell on destructive issues.
  5. Pure: The leader disciplines his or her mind to remain clean and pure.
  6. Secure: The leader is firm, stable in his identity and source of strength.
